On May 19, 2024, troops from the Nigerian Army's 6 Brigade and Operation Whirl Stroke (OPWS) carried out successful operations in Taraba State, arresting six suspected kidnappers.


 In Chinkai Village, Wukari Local Government Area, soldiers from the 93 Battalion, Sub-Sector 3B, apprehended Usman Gide Ali and Abdulrahman Amadu, who attempted to bribe them with N2 million, which the troops refused. 


Another operation in Ibi Local Government Area led to the capture of four more suspects: Jafaru Banyi, Mohammad Ardo, Amadu Lawal Shatta, and Biyu Ardu, all linked to high-profile kidnappings.


Brigadier General Kingsley Uwa praised the soldiers' professionalism and integrity in rejecting the bribe and emphasized the importance of their commitment to justice.


These operations highlight the army's ongoing efforts to combat kidnapping and maintain security in the region.
